Transaction 8ea8283497924fbed7bdc64fb137ad22c95a6285a1be911871d451d795100bf3
1 Input
1 Output
-
8ea8283497924fbed7bdc64fb137ad22c95a6285a1be911871d451d795100bf3:0
- value
- 2079288
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cb76ea33cb0eb488a84f3d5c0bb21effb36f507
- address
- bc1q3jmkageukr453z5y702upwepalandag8gty9dh